Understanding the Mechanics of Automated Gameplay

At its core, afk spin relies on exploiting repetitive game loops – sequences of actions that a player would normally perform manually. These loops can range from simple tasks like collecting resources to more complex activities like battling weaker enemies or navigating basic challenges. The key is to identify actions that yield consistent rewards without requiring constant player input. This often involves leveraging in-game automation features, scripting tools, or even physical workarounds involving button mashing or joystick manipulation. However, the legality and permissibility of these methods vary significantly between games.

Many games actively discourage or outright prohibit the use of any third-party tools or scripts designed to automate gameplay. Violating these terms of service can lead to account suspension or permanent bans. Therefore, it’s crucial to understand the specific policies of the game in question before attempting to implement afk spin. Some developers are more tolerant of simple automation techniques, viewing them as a legitimate way for players to enjoy the game at their own pace. Others take a much stricter stance, considering any form of automation as cheating and a disruption to the game's ecosystem. This is where understanding the game’s community feedback is vital.

The popularity of afk spin has also prompted developers to respond with counter-measures. These include implementing stricter anti-bot detection systems, adding inactivity timers that log players out, or introducing mechanics that punish prolonged periods of inactivity. As a result, the techniques used for afk spin are constantly evolving, as players seek new ways to circumvent these safeguards. Staying informed about these changes is essential for anyone looking to effectively utilize this strategy.

Mitigating Risks and Avoiding Detection

As previously mentioned, the use of afk spin carries inherent risks, primarily the potential for account suspension or permanent ban. To mitigate these risks, it’s crucial to proceed with caution and adhere to the game’s terms of service. Using officially sanctioned automation features, if available, is the safest approach. If resorting to third-party tools or scripts, it’s essential to research their reputation and ensure that they are not flagged as malicious or exploitative. Furthermore, it’s important to avoid actions that are clearly prohibited, such as automating actions that require human input or circumventing anti-cheat measures.

Another important consideration is the potential for bot detection. Many games employ sophisticated algorithms to identify and penalize players who are using automated systems. These algorithms can detect patterns of behavior that are inconsistent with human play, such as perfectly timed actions or repetitive movements. To avoid detection, it’s important to introduce some level of randomness into the afk spin routine. This can involve varying the timing of actions, incorporating small delays, or randomly switching between different tasks. More sophisticated players may even mimic human behavior by occasionally pausing the routine or making slight adjustments.

  1. Always review the game’s terms of service before implementing afk spin.
  2. Prioritize using officially sanctioned automation features.
  3. Avoid using third-party tools that are flagged as malicious or exploitative.
  4. Introduce randomness into the afk spin routine to avoid detection.
  5. Monitor your account for any unusual activity or warnings.

It’s also important to be mindful of the game’s community. Reporting suspected botters is a common practice, and getting flagged by other players can increase the likelihood of being investigated. Maintaining a low profile and avoiding bragging about your afk spin setup can help to minimize this risk.
